Navigating the Risks: BMS Digital Safety Best Practices
Protecting your Building Management System (BMS) from digital threats is critically important for operational stability. Enacting robust digital safety measures is no longer an option, but a imperative. Below are key best approaches to reduce risk:
- Frequently conduct security audits to pinpoint vulnerabilities .
- Require strong, distinct passwords and layered authentication for all user profiles .
- Segment your BMS system from other corporate networks to limit potential damage .
- Keep all BMS applications and hardware to the current versions to address known safety issues .
- Offer complete security education to all employees who use the BMS.
Embracing these tactics will substantially improve your BMS digital safety posture and safeguard your critical building infrastructure.

Cybersecurity for Building Management Systems: A Critical Overview
Building management platforms, vital for contemporary infrastructure, are increasingly susceptible to digital threats. These sophisticated systems, which control everything from climate and illumination to access and HVAC, present a substantial challenge for building managers. Historically, many control systems were designed without adequate protection, get more info making them easy targets for malicious actors. The potential impact of a successful attack can be devastating, including disruption of critical services, economic losses, and damage to brand. A proactive and layered approach is therefore essential, encompassing periodic vulnerability assessments, robust verification protocols, and continuous monitoring of system behavior.
